Technical Features of Hoists and Cranes

Understanding the technical features of hoists and cranes is crucial for selecting the right equipment for specific applications. Below is a comparison table highlighting key technical features:

Feature Hoists Cranes
Load Capacity Up to 100 tons Up to 1,000 tons
Power Source Electric, pneumatic, manual Electric, hydraulic
Control Type Pendant, remote, manual Pendant, remote, cab control
Mobility Fixed or portable Fixed (overhead) or mobile
Safety Features Overload protection, limit switches Anti-collision systems, emergency stops
Installation Simple, often DIY Requires professional installation
Maintenance Needs Regular inspections, lubrication Comprehensive inspections, load testing

Types of Hoists and Cranes

Different types of hoists and cranes serve various purposes and industries. The following table outlines the primary types and their characteristics:

Type Description Applications
Electric Hoists Powered by electricity, ideal for repetitive tasks Manufacturing, warehouses
Chain Hoists Uses a chain for lifting, suitable for heavy loads Construction, industrial settings
Jib Cranes Fixed to a wall or column, allows for horizontal movement Workshops, assembly lines
Bridge Cranes Overhead cranes with a bridge that moves along rails Factories, shipping yards
Gantry Cranes Similar to bridge cranes but with legs that support the structure Outdoor applications, shipyards
Monorail Cranes Single rail system for lightweight lifting Assembly lines, small workshops

FAQs

1. What types of hoists are available?
There are several types of hoists, including electric hoists, chain hoists, and manual hoists, each designed for specific lifting needs.

2. How often should cranes be inspected?
Cranes should be inspected regularly, typically every six months, or more frequently depending on usage and industry regulations.

3. What safety features should I look for in a crane?
Look for features such as overload protection, emergency stops, and anti-collision systems to ensure safe operation.

4. Can I install a hoist or crane myself?
While some hoists can be installed by the user, cranes typically require professional installation due to their complexity and safety requirements.

5. How can I ensure my equipment remains compliant with OSHA regulations?
Regular inspections, maintenance, and training for operators are essential to ensure compliance with OSHA regulations and to maintain safety standards.
